Processor Specs

Intel Core i5-6500ProcessorIntel Core i7-5700HQ
3200 MHzFrequency2700 MHz
3600 MHzMaximum Frequency3500 MHz
4Cores4
4Threads8
65 WTDP47 W
Intel HD Graphics 530GPU
SkylakeCodenameBroadwell
FCLGA1151PackageFCBGA1364
